Gwinn’s climate situates it firmly within a northern freeze zone, which shapes the predominant water damage risks its homeowners face. With annual precipitation near 29.2 inches, slightly below the U.S. mid-range, the area experiences moisture challenges not from heavy rainfall but from seasonal freeze-thaw cycles. The primary threats arise from frozen and subsequently burst pipes during harsh winter months, often exacerbated by insufficient insulation or unheated crawl spaces. Ice dams forming along roof edges during extended cold spells create leaks that can saturate attic insulation and ceilings, a frequent issue in Gwinn’s aging housing stock.
Additionally, spring snowmelt represents a secondary yet significant source of water intrusion. As accumulated snow rapidly melts, groundwater levels rise, occasionally overwhelming drainage systems, which can lead to basement flooding especially when sump pumps fail or are overwhelmed. Although Gwinn’s flood zone risk is categorized as low, these localized flooding events tied to seasonal thawing cycles remain a persistent hazard for homeowners. The most recent federally declared water disaster in 2025 underscores the ongoing nature of these threats, dispelling any notion that water damage here is merely a historic concern.
Many residents underestimate the cyclical nature of these water damage risks. Unlike more flood-prone southern regions, Gwinn’s primary vulnerabilities derive from cold-weather phenomena that stress plumbing and roofing systems annually. This recurring freeze damage, combined with localized springtime seepage, means that water intrusion and structural compromise are risks that require year-round vigilance. Understanding the interplay between Gwinn’s geography and climate conditions helps homeowners prioritize protective measures suited to these specific environmental pressures.

Many Gwinn residents assume that water damage concerns peak solely during spring flooding, but the reality extends beyond that narrow window. The most critical period for water intrusion here spans from November through April, encompassing the coldest months when freezing temperatures frequently cause pipe bursts and ice dam formation on roofs. During these months, ice dams develop as snow melts unevenly, forcing water under shingles and into attic spaces. Additionally, frozen pipes may crack due to sustained cold, releasing water into walls and floors once thawed.
Outside this high-risk interval, summer and early fall still carry potential threats. Moderate mold growth can occur due to lingering moisture from humid conditions, especially in basements where older sump pumps might be less effective. Fall is an ideal time to clear gutters and inspect drainage pathways to prepare for winter, reducing the likelihood of ice dam development and water backup. Winterization steps such as insulating pipes, applying heat tape, and maintaining a slow faucet drip during freezing nights are critical preventive measures to undertake before the first freeze.
Spring’s snowmelt adds a second surge of risk due to rapid runoff overwhelming drainage systems and sump pumps. Homeowners should ensure sump pumps are operational and consider backup power sources to maintain function during power outages. Landscaping adjustments to improve grading away from foundations also help mitigate basement seepage. By understanding these seasonal patterns and taking targeted actions throughout the year, Gwinn residents can better shield their homes from the cyclical water damage challenges posed by the local climate.

Deciding between handling water damage yourself or bringing in a professional in Gwinn often hinges on the scale and complexity of the problem. Small leaks or minor appliance overflows that affect a contained area might be manageable with household tools and prompt drying. However, once standing water extends beyond one room or involves contaminated sources like a malfunctioning sump pump backflow or a cracked toilet supply line, the situation typically exceeds DIY capabilities. Water contacting electrical systems or failing to evaporate within a day are further triggers signaling the need for expert intervention.
Professional teams equipped with industrial-grade drying apparatus and certified by the Institute of Inspection, Cleaning and Restoration Certification (IICRC) bring specialized knowledge and technology that can arrest damage progression and prevent secondary issues such as mold growth. The threshold between minor and moderate damage in Gwinn commonly corresponds to repair costs starting around $3,500, reflecting scenarios where multiple rooms or structural elements are affected. These situations demand rapid, thorough response beyond what consumer-grade equipment can provide.

Imagine a Gwinn homeowner discovering that their basement has flooded following the spring thaw. They turn to their insurance policy, hoping it covers the costly cleanup and repairs. In Michigan, standard homeowner policies typically cover sudden, accidental water damage events such as a ruptured hot water tank or an unexpected pipe leak. However, coverage for flooding caused by natural water accumulation or slow, progressive seepage is often excluded or requires separate flood insurance. Given Gwinn’s low flood zone risk but frequent spring snowmelt flooding, many residents find themselves navigating these nuanced policy distinctions.
Michigan law provides homeowners up to six years to file a claim after water damage occurs, which is a longer window than in many states. This extended deadline offers some relief in documenting and processing claims, but prompt notification remains crucial to avoid complications. Basement flooding is the state’s most common water damage issue, so securing sewer backup coverage is strongly recommended, as this is typically not included in basic policies. Understanding these coverage gaps helps Gwinn residents avoid surprises when repair bills arrive.
Financially, major water damage repairs in Gwinn can consume nearly a third of a home’s market value, creating intense pressure on families. Assistance programs such as FEMA disaster aid and Small Business Administration disaster loans provide vital resources to bridge these cost burdens. Many restoration companies also offer payment plans, making the expense more manageable. To support a smooth insurance claim, homeowners should meticulously document damage with photos and maintain detailed records of any emergency mitigation efforts, which can strengthen their case and expedite processing.

In Gwinn, Michigan, the financial impact of water damage repairs varies broadly depending on severity, with three distinct tiers defining typical costs. Minor water damage, often limited to a single room or appliance issue such as a malfunctioning dishwasher causing localized flooding, generally ranges between $800 and $3,500. These expenses are usually manageable for many households, especially when addressed promptly to prevent escalation. Moderate damage, which might involve multiple rooms affected by a failing sump pump or a leaking water heater, tends to cost between $3,500 and $10,500. This level of repair can strain local family budgets, considering the town’s median household income of $46,414.
For major damage scenarios, costs escalate substantially, falling between $10,500 and $35,000. This might arise from extensive basement flooding due to spring snowmelt combined with foundation cracks, or prolonged roof leaks caused by ice dams leading to structural and mold issues. To frame this in local terms, a $35,000 expense represents approximately 31% of Gwinn’s median home value of $112,166 — effectively consuming nearly a third of the property’s worth. Moreover, this major repair cost equates to about nine months of income for the average household, underscoring the financial pressure such damage imposes.
The local cost multiplier of 0.70 compared to national averages means that Gwinn’s restoration expenses are generally lower than in densely populated urban markets. Labor costs and material availability reflect the rural setting, but the tradeoff includes potential delays and limited contractor options. Early detection and intervention remain critical: addressing a cracked water supply line promptly can prevent a cascade of damage that might otherwise push costs from minor to major tiers.
